What is the best way to do mouse over image scrolling?

First off, I am not a professional web developer. I develop and maintain my company website that was originally done using FrontPage and now I plan to revamp it using Expression Web 2. I can do this, no problem, but there is something I'm not sure how to do.

I want to have a line of thumbnails that will scroll to right and left on mouse over and have a large image box that will show the thumbnail mouse-over or mouse-click image.

I would like to know what the best way of accomplishing this would be. I have found some tutorials doing this with JavaScript. Is this the best method or are there better ways?
